O Christ
to You we have returned
The Shepherd of our souls;
Who bore our sins upon the tree
To heal and make us whole.
To seek that forlorn
wayward sheep
You left the ninety-nine;
The sinner on Your shoulders bore;
Earth’s joy and heaven’s combine!
To You who give eternal life
Good Shepherd
we give thanks;
You know our names—as we Your voice—
And hold us in Your hands.
From many “folds” You led us out
To be one flock divine;
Our Shepherd
Door
our Pasture too
Through You real rest we find.
Dear Lamb
our Shepherd on the throne
You guide us all the way
To springs of waters
founts of life;
Each tear You wipe away.
Jesus
Great Shepherd of the Church
How faithful is Your care—
Inclusive
gentle
rich
and strong
Both present and fore’er.
Grant us a shepherd’s heart
like Yours
With tenderest concern;
To feed Your sheep
to nurse Your lambs
Of You we all will learn.
May we be carers of men’s souls
With You
Chief Shepherd dear;
A crown of glory we’ll receive
The hour when You appear.
